How to Buy Dogecoin: A Comprehensive Guide359
Dogecoin is a popular cryptocurrency that has gained significant attention in recent years. As a result, many people are interested in learning how to buy Dogecoin. This guide will provide you with all the information you need to know about buying Dogecoin, from choosing the right exchange to storing your coins securely.
Choose an Exchange
The first step to buying Dogecoin is to choose a cryptocurrency exchange. There are many different exchanges available, so it is important to do your research and choose one that is reputable and trustworthy. Some of the most popular exchanges for buying Dogecoin include:* Binance
* Coinbase
* Kraken
* Gemini
* Robinhood
When choosing an exchange, it is important to consider factors such as fees, security, and ease of use. You should also make sure that the exchange supports Dogecoin trading in your country.
Create an Account
Once you have chosen an exchange, you will need to create an account. This process will typically involve providing your name, email address, and password. You may also be asked to provide additional information, such as your phone number or address.
Fund Your Account
Before you can buy Dogecoin, you will need to fund your account with fiat currency (e.g., USD, EUR, GBP). There are a number of different ways to do this, including bank transfers, credit cards, and debit cards. The specific methods available will vary depending on the exchange you choose.
Buy Dogecoin
Once you have funded your account, you can place an order to buy Dogecoin. The order form will typically ask you to specify the amount of Dogecoin you want to buy and the price you are willing to pay. Once you have entered all of the necessary information, click the "Buy" button to place your order.
Store Your Dogecoin
Once you have purchased Dogecoin, you will need to store it securely. There are a number of different ways to store Dogecoin, including hardware wallets, software wallets, and paper wallets. Hardware wallets are the most secure option, but they can be expensive. Software wallets are less secure, but they are more convenient. Tips for Buying Dogecoin
Here are a few tips to help you buy Dogecoin safely and securely:* Do your research and choose a reputable and trustworthy exchange.
* Create a strong password and enable two-factor authentication.
* Store your Dogecoin in a secure wallet.
* Only buy as much Dogecoin as you can afford to lose.
* Be aware of the risks involved in investing in cryptocurrency.
